Episode 94: Media Psychology
Jun 26, 2024โข56 min
Episode description
My guest for Episode 94 is Dorothy Andrews, ASA, MAAA, PhD, Senior Behavioral Data Scientist and Actuary at NAIC.
The theme for the episode is ๐ ๐ฒ๐ฑ๐ถ๐ฎ ๐ฃ๐๐๐ฐ๐ต๐ผ๐น๐ผ๐ด๐.
Dorothy and I explore the following topics:โฃ
โ The link between media, data, and algorithms
โ Pitfalls in using big data to gain cognitive insights
โ The relevance of psychology for building models
โ The link between correlation and causation
โ Rational explanations for variable relationships
โ Natural experiments and randomized controlled trialsย
โ The link between cognitive bias and cognitive dissonance
โ Bias in traffic ticketing, health diagnoses, and loss ratio modelingย
โ Potential downstream societal implications of biasย
โ How the insurance industry is addressing negative bias
